The LV846174 is a MasterPact MTZ2 3-pole drawout circuit breaker, rated 2000 A at 40 °C. It's built for power distribution protection — main or tie breaker in a switchboard, protecting transformers, busbars, or large feeders. Category B selectivity means it coordinates with downstream breakers to isolate only the faulted branch.
Drawout mounting and panel fit
Drawout mounting means the breaker chassis stays wired to the bus; the moving portion slides out for maintenance or swap without pulling the whole switchboard apart. Mounting support is rails or base plate — standard for switchgear cubicles. The 441 mm width, 439 mm height, and 403 mm depth fit typical low-voltage switchgear compartments; connection pitch is 115 mm. Upside and downside connections accept front or rear terminations, so it adapts to existing busbar runs or cable ladders.
The Icw short-time withstand of 100 kA for 1 s (75 kA for 3 s) is what makes Category B selectivity work — it rides through a downstream fault long enough for the branch breaker to clear, then opens only if the fault persists. Making capacity Icm is 220 kA at 440 V, which covers the asymmetric peak on the first half-cycle. For coordination studies, the 25 ms maximum breaking time and 70 ms maximum closing response time are the numbers to plug into your time-current curves.

What the standards and environmental ratings cover
The LV846174 carries EN/IEC 60947-1, -2, and Annex H (for selectivity under earth-fault conditions), plus IEC 61557-12 for performance measurement and monitoring. Operating altitude is 0–2000 m without derating, 2000–5000 m with derating. IP30 protection means tools or fingers won't reach live parts, but it's not sealed against water — install in a cabinet. The 470 W power dissipation at rated current matters for ventilation sizing in the enclosure.
